National Press Day ( NPD ) is observed every year across India on 16 November to commemorate the day the Press Council of India (PCI) began functioning, safeguarding journalistic standards and protecting press freedom.
Theme:
2025 Theme: “Safeguarding Press Credibility amidst Rising Misinformation”
Focus: The theme focuses on countering misinformation in the digital and Artificial Intelligence (AI) age.
Background:
Commission: The 1st Press Commission in 1954 recommended creating a statutory authority composed of industry-linked members to uphold professional ethics in journalism.
Establishment: The PCI was established on 4 July 1966 under the Press Council Act, 1965.
The PCI began functioning as a watchdog body on 16 November 1966.
